Price Ranges

Considering a robot lawn mower? Understanding the price ranges is crucial. These advanced mowers come in various price categories. This section breaks down the cost into three main categories: Budget-Friendly Options, Mid-Range Models, and High-End Choices.

Budget-friendly Options

For those on a tighter budget, there are several affordable robot lawn mowers. These models typically range from $200 to $600. They may have fewer features but still get the job done.

  • Basic navigation systems
  • Limited scheduling capabilities
  • Suitable for small lawns

Mid-range Models

Mid-range models offer a balance of features and price. These robot mowers usually cost between $600 and $1,200. You get better performance and more advanced features.

  • Improved navigation systems
  • Enhanced scheduling options
  • Suitable for medium-sized lawns

High-end Choices

If you want top-of-the-line performance, high-end models are the way to go. These advanced mowers can cost anywhere from $1,200 to over $3,000. They offer the best features and performance.

  • Advanced navigation systems
  • Comprehensive scheduling capabilities
  • Suitable for large lawns

Additional Costs

When investing in a robot lawn mower, consider the additional costs beyond the initial purchase price. These costs can include installation, maintenance and repairs, and accessories. Understanding these expenses helps you budget better and ensures smooth operation of your robot lawn mower.

Installation

Proper installation is crucial for efficient operation. You may need to purchase a boundary wire to define the mowing area. Professional installation services can cost between $200 to $500, depending on your lawn size and complexity. Some models come with a do-it-yourself installation kit, which can save on costs but may require some effort and precision.

Maintenance And Repairs

Maintaining your robot lawn mower is essential for its longevity. Regular maintenance includes cleaning, blade replacement, and software updates. Cleaning and minor maintenance tasks can be done at home, but professional services might be required for more complex issues.

Typical maintenance costs:

  • Blade replacement: $20 to $50 annually.
  • Battery replacement: $100 to $300 every few years.
  • Professional servicing: $100 to $200 per visit.

Repair costs vary depending on the issue. It’s advisable to check the warranty and service plans offered by the manufacturer.

Accessories

Various accessories can enhance the functionality of your robot lawn mower. Common accessories include:

  1. Garage or Shelter: Protects the mower from weather, costing $100 to $300.
  2. Additional Boundary Wire: Needed for larger lawns, priced at $50 to $150.
  3. Anti-theft Devices: Provides security, usually costing $50 to $100.

These accessories can improve the efficiency and lifespan of your robot lawn mower, but they add to the overall cost.

Best-selling Models

Certain models from these top brands have gained popularity among users. These models offer excellent performance and good value for money.

The Husqvarna Automower 315X is a favorite for medium-sized lawns. It features GPS navigation and a mobile app for remote control. It is efficient and easy to use.

The Worx Landroid WR150 is ideal for larger lawns. It has a rain sensor and a modular battery system. The Landroid WR150 offers great performance and convenience.

Robomow’s RS630 is designed for large lawns. It has a powerful cutting system and can be controlled via a smartphone app. The RS630 is robust and reliable.
